Understanding Sanitary Diaphragm Valves

Sanitary diaphragm valves are designed to meet stringent cleanliness requirements, making them ideal for industries such as pharmaceuticals, food and beverage, and water treatment. The core functionality lies in the diaphragm, a flexible barrier that separates the fluid from the valve body, ensuring minimal contamination and easy maintenance.

Key Benefits of Sanitary Diaphragm Valves

These valves provide several advantages, including:

  • High flow rates with minimal pressure drop
  • Versatility in handling viscous and corrosive fluids
  • Easy cleaning and sanitization due to openbody designs
  • Long service life with durable materials

The Impact of Diaphragm Valve Flow Rates

Diaphragm valve flow rates are a critical factor in fluid system performance. roper design ensures smooth and consistent flow, reducing turbulence and energy loss. In industries where precise dosing is essential, such as chemical processing, even minor fluctuations in flow rates can impact product quality.

Optimizing Flow Rates Through Diaphragm Design

The diaphragm design plays a pivotal role in determining flow rates. Factors such as diaphragm thickness, material composition, and valve geometry influence efficiency. Modern innovations focus on creating thinner, more flexible diaphragms that enhance turbulence reduction while maintaining structural integrity.

Enhancing Sanitary Diaphragm Valve erformance

In fluid systems, maintaining hygiene is paramount. Sanitary diaphragm valves excel in this regard, as their design minimizes dead spaces where contaminants can accumulate. Regular inspection and proper diaphragm design ensure longterm efficiency and compliance with industry standards.
